Transaction d66ee143eba6403a23dfaa76b4909a5e00c2ea30e493d18d598ddb6c298a9b79
1 Input
1 Output
-
d66ee143eba6403a23dfaa76b4909a5e00c2ea30e493d18d598ddb6c298a9b79:0
- value
- 113320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 639b31e22d8a387682f4cfd4b632f2e1545dfc81 OP_EQUAL
- address
- 3AmgjfPam97ykCkzG3BEEEFpb9TSf8pVR4